Transaction 5568fa885c006ae180ca326ef642459463d57702dbaa244fe9d507d77d2c51e5

1 Input
2 Outputs
  • 5568fa885c006ae180ca326ef642459463d57702dbaa244fe9d507d77d2c51e5:0
  • value  1948472
    address  19RVaakLnL9wfhfEg1XuTdydnVrPfHioFe
  • 5568fa885c006ae180ca326ef642459463d57702dbaa244fe9d507d77d2c51e5:1
  • value  5600000
    address  1Wh8yk7Qnb2S1LWEu5gTX7dtdj2UnGytT